Book Details
Table of Contents
pt. 1. Say that we saw Spain die
The wound that will not heal : terror and truth
The capital of the world : the correspondents and the Siege of Madrid
The lost generation divided : Hemingway, Dos Passos, and the disappearance of Jose Robles
Love and politics : the correspondents in Valencia and Barcelona
The rebel zone : intimidation in Salamanca and Burgos
pt. 2. Beyond journalism
Stalin's eyes and ears in Madrid? : the rise and fall of Mikhail Koltsov
A man of influence : the case of Louis Fischer
The sentimental adventurer : George Steer and the quest for lost causes
Talking with Franco, trouble with Hitler : Jay Allen
pt. 3. After the war
The humane observer : Henry Buckley
A lifetime's struggle : Herbert Rutledge Southworth and the undermining of the Franco regime.
